Adulterated Olive Oil and Expired Foodstuffs Seized in Nablus

 

Ramallah - 8/12/2025 The Customs Police, in cooperation with the Economic Security Team and the Public Safety Committee, seized approximately 765 kilograms of adulterated olive oil, unfit for human consumption, from a shop in Nablus on Monday.

The relevant authorities ordered the seizure of the goods pending completion of legal procedures.

In a separate incident, acting on information received, the Customs Police seized 400 kilograms of expired food products from another shop.

The relevant authorities from the Ministries of National Economy and Industry were summoned and ordered the destruction of the seized quantity and the completion of all necessary legal procedures.
